HOW TO MAKE YOUR OWN OVERNIGHT OATS
TIPS AND TRICKS:
> Prep ingredients the night before. Overnight oats are really easy to assemble. But you want to give the oats some time to fully soak up the milk and plain greek yogurt, and the best time to do that is the night before. 

> Eat overnight oats cold or hot. Most people prefer to eat their overnight oats cold - this is what makes them an easy on-the-go breakfast. This might take a bit of getting used to. So if you think that eating cold oats is just too weird, you can warm them up in the microwave. 

> Add your favorite toppings. Some toppings I recommend trying are berries, bananas, apples, oranges, nuts, hemp seeds, sunflower seeds, pumpkin seeds, sun butter, shredded coconut, raisins, and anything else you feel like experimenting with.

> When you're ready to eat, stir it up and enjoy. Overnights are pretty straightforward to eat. Take a spoon and stir them up - then take a bite. They’re wonderfully satisfying and delicious.

> Make your overnight oats enjoyable for your own tastes. Once you try out a few recipes and learn what you like, start playing around with different combinations. These overnight oats are easily adaptable - try different fruits, nuts or seeds, don't be afraid to swap any ingredients out. Or if you want to add some superfoods like chia seeds or hemp seeds, go for it.

That's it! When you know these simple tips and tricks, you can easily make your own creations. To get you started, below are six delicious overnight oat recipes to try at home. 1. VANILLA OVERNIGHT OATS

  • 1/2 cup old fashioned rolled oats
  • 1/3 cup plain gre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up milk (dairy or dairy-free alternative)
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1 Tbsp maple syrup
  • pinch of sea salt
  • Vanilla overnight oats are a classic simple flavor. To make your overnight oats, simply combine all ingredients in a bowl and pour it into a mason jar. Let sit in the fridge overnight, then add your favorite toppings in the morning before you eat.

2. CHOCOLATE OVERNIGHT OATS

  • 1/2 cup old fashioned rolled oats
  • 1/3 cup plain gre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up milk (dairy or dairy-free alternative)
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1 Tbsp maple syrup
  • pinch of sea salt
  • 1.5 Tbsp cocoa powder
  • optional toppings: shredded coconut, a few dark chocolate chips, and a sprinkle of cocoa powder
  • These chocolate overnight oats are soo yummy! To make your overnight oats, simply combine all ingredients in a bowl and pour it into the mason jar. Let sit in the fridge overnight, then add your favorite toppings in the morning before you eat.

3. SEED BUTTER OVERNIGHT OATS
  • 1/2 cup old fashioned rolled oats
  • 1/3 cup plain gre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up milk (dairy or dairy-free alternative)
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1 Tbsp maple syrup
  • pinch of sea salt
  • 2 Tbsp nut butter or sunbutter
  • optional toppings: a dollop of sunbutter, nut butter, nuts and seeds
To make the seed butter overnight oats, simply combine all ingredients in a bowl and pour it into a mason jar. Let sit in the fridge overnight, then add your favorite toppings in the morning before you eat.

4. PUMPKIN SPICED OVERNIGHT OATS
  • 1/2 cup old fashioned rolled oats
  • 1/3 cup plain gre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up milk (dairy or dairy-free alternative)
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1 Tbsp maple syrup
  • pinch of sea salt
  • 1/4 cup pumpkin puree
  • 1 tsp pumpkin pie spice
The pumpkin spiced overnight oats are perfect for Fall! Simply combine all ingredients in a bowl and pour it into a mason jar. Let sit in the fridge overnight, then add your favorite toppings in the morning before you eat.

5. Banana raspberry OVERNIGHT OATS
  • 1/2 cup old fashioned rolled oats
  • 1/3 cup plain gre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up milk (dairy or dairy-free alternative)
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1 Tbsp maple syrup
  • pinch of sea salt
  • 1/2 ripe banana, mashed
  • 1/2 cup raspberries, mashed with a fork To make these banana raspberry overnight oats, simply combine all ingredients in a bowl and pour it into a mason jar. Let sit in the fridge overnight, then add your favorite toppings in the morning before you eat.

6. APPLE CINNAMON OVERNIGHT OATS

  • 1/2 cup old fashioned rolled oats
  • 1/3 cup plain gre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up milk (dairy or dairy-free alternative)
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1 Tbsp maple syrup
  • pinch of sea salt
  • 1/3 apple diced small
  • 1 tsp cinnamon

To make the apple cinnamon overnight oats, simply combine all ingredients in a bowl and pour it into a mason jar. Let sit in the fridge overnight, then add your favorite toppings in the morning before you eat.
